The invention relates to the field of aerostats, in particular to an aerostat solar cell support device which comprises a first annular truss and a second annular truss which are fixed to the outer surface of an aerostat, the first truss and the second truss are concentrically arranged, and the first truss and the second truss are connected to the outer surface of the aerostat through loop fasteners; the first truss and the second truss are each provided with a plurality of evenly-arranged supporting rods, and the top ends of the supporting rods are connected with the net-shaped bracket on the upper portion. A skin is arranged on the net-shaped bracket, and a solar cell is laid on the skin. The hard support is installed on the topmost portion of the aerostat, the solar panel battery is flatly laid on the support and directly faces the sun, the total number of solar panels can be reduced, the support is made of light high-strength carbon fiber tubes, overall assembly is flexible, an aerostat capsule is not damaged, disassembly is convenient, the occupied space is small, and control is easy.
